Mine are 1ft tall and have flower buds. The plants have been outside, day and night,  for 2 weeks now and don't appear to suffer. So I decided to plant them out on the plot, unprotected. The tunnel cloche, which I had planned to use for my aubergines, will now be used for the peppers, which are still tiny.

I sowed the see mid Feb and raised the plants on a sunny window sill. The variety is Diamond from The Real Seed Catalogue.
